Ict Module Level 3
INTRODUCTION In this research we have survey the product performance and buying behavior of coffee, which are drank by people of all ages. During this research we have interacted with people of all ages. After this research we came to know how people perceive coffee on the variables like price, amount, brand loyalty etc. We also came to know which particular brand of coffee is most preferred by people of different age groups. In this research we have surveyed that how frequently and how much coffee they drink, whether they buy small or big cup.

Ethical considerations
1.I should have the permission of the people who you will be studying to conduct research involving them.
2. I don’t want to do anything that would cause physical or emotional harm to your subjects. This could be something as simple as being careful how you word sensitive or difficult questions during your interviews.
3. Objectivity against subjectivity in my research project is another important consideration. Be sure personal biases and opinions do not get in the way of this research and so that I give both sides a fair consideration.
4. When doing research, be sure I am not taking advantage of easy-to-access groups of people (such as all of my classmates in IFP) simply because they are easy to access. I’ll make my subjects based on what would most benefit my research.

    Participating in a research study is an opportunity for people to contribute to the advancement of healthcare practice or other measures. Researchers typically collect data from a population of people that share common characteristics that make them appropriate subjects for the area being studied. In order to assure that participants are adequately protected, a set of ethical principles should be adhered to by all research facilitators. “The Belmont Report articulates three primary ethical principles on which standards of ethical conduct in research are based: beneficence, respect for human dignity, and justice” (Beck & Polit, 2006).…

    Information and communication technologies (ICT) is an umbrella term that covers all advanced technologies in manipulating and communicating information. The term is sometimes used in preference to information technology (IT), particularly on these two communities: education and government. The common usage ICT is synonymous assumed the fact that IT or ICT encompasses all mediums, to record information (magnetic disk/tape, optical disks (CD/DVD), flash memory etc. and arguably also paper records); technology for broadcasting information - radio, television; and technology for communicating through voice and sound or images - microphone, camera, loudspeaker, telephone to cellular phones. It includes the wide varieties of computing hardware (PCs, servers, mainframes, networked storage).…
